Finding Your Niche

The first step in launching your online business is finding your niche. This involves researching market trends and identifying areas where there's demand but perhaps not enough supply. It's also crucial to consider your own passions and skills. By combining market opportunities with your interests, you'll be more likely to succeed in the long run.

Market Analysis

Once you've pinpointed your niche, it's time to conduct a thorough market analysis. This includes assessing your competition and understanding your target audience. By gaining insights into what your competitors are doing well (or not so well) and knowing who your potential customers are, you'll be better equipped to position your business for success.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

SEO is the process of optimizing your website to rank higher in search engine results pages. By understanding the basics of SEO and conducting keyword research, you can increase your visibility online and drive more traffic to your website. This, in turn, can lead to more leads and sales for your business.

Driving Traffic to Your Website

Once your website is up and running, the next step is to drive traffic to it. This can be done through a combination of organic and paid methods, such as search engine marketing (SEM), social media advertising, and email marketing. Building an email list is particularly important for cultivating long-term relationships with your audience.

FAQs

  1. How much money do I need to start an online business?

    • The amount of money you need to start an online business varies depending on the type of business you want to start and your individual circumstances. Some businesses can be started with very little capital, while others may require a significant investment.
  2. How long does it take to see results from an online business?

    • The timeline for seeing results from an online business can vary widely depending on factors such as your niche, your marketing efforts, and the quality of your products or services. Some businesses may see results relatively quickly, while others may take longer to gain traction.
  3. Do I need to have technical skills to start an online business?

    • While having technical skills can certainly be helpful when starting an online business, they're not necessarily required. Many tools and platforms make it easy for non-technical entrepreneurs to build and manage their online presence.
  4. What are some common mistakes to avoid when starting an online business?

    • Some common mistakes to avoid when starting an online business include failing to conduct market research, neglecting to build a strong brand, and underestimating the importance of customer service. It's also important to avoid spreading yourself too thin by trying to do everything at once.
